Highlights
Are people in Hemet older or younger than people in Maypearl?
- The Median Age in Hemet is 8.8 years older than in Maypearl.

Are housing costs cheaper in Hemet or Maypearl?
- Hemet housing costs are 23.1% more expensive than Maypearl hous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Hemet or Maypearl?
- The average commute for residents of Hemet is 1.7 minutes longer than it is for residents of Maypearl.
